Output 51b9cb427d8fe5fbadc0a8298699a9b5de2b524fb276c44a66d8b16e76fb76f0:3

value
30620060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53183bf41513018120b1349df7f635f0ffdba31 OP_EQUAL
address
MUo2HhMndhBHnnYcFZHpm7gNaDNPKSHKgN
transaction
51b9cb427d8fe5fbadc0a8298699a9b5de2b524fb276c44a66d8b16e76fb76f0
spent
true